Abstract
We present a sequential version of the multilinear Nyström algorithm which is suitable for low-rank Tucker approximation of tensors given in a streaming format. Accessing the tensor exclusively through random sketches of the original data, the algorithm effectively leverages structures in , such as low-rankness, and linear combinations. We present a deterministic analysis of the algorithm and demonstrate its superior speed and efficiency in numerical experiments including an application in video processing.

The purpose of Applied Mathematics Letters is to provide a means of rapid publication for important but brief applied mathematical papers. The brief descriptions of any work involving a novel application or utilization of mathematics, or a development in the methodology of applied mathematics is a potential contribution for this journal. This journal''s focus is on applied mathematics topics based on differential equations and linear algebra. Priority will be given to submissions that are likely to appeal to a wide audience.
